I’ve ridden XCMs on Maxxis Rekon 2.4, Rekon Race 2.4 and Continental Race King 2.2.

Rekon felt very safe for the course I did, it was rainy and muddy with a mix of gravel and pine forrest.

They felt a bit slow so I changed to Rekon Race and they felt pretty much the same, were faster but I was on dryer course.

I used RaceKings this Sunday on that same course and they felt way more competent on technical terrain than I thought but I did not like them for that kind of race. I usually use them for more or less gravel races.

I’ll probably only use the Rekons for really wet and muddy conditions, the Rekon Race will probably be used mostly if it’s not a gravel ride.

I’d say, whatever you choose don’t swap them last minute, it’s important to get comfortable with the new tyres and know how they behave and what pressure you should use.
